This will be my 3rd CVT transmission Toyota RAV4 hybrid  and  Toyota Prius Plus hybrid now the Lexus Hybrid 

The first I time I drove the Prius hybrid I turned the ignition key on  silence turn it off then back on silence 

Strange I thought still wouldn't start. Then a bolt of lighting 

Er Phillip the car is ready to go ( you get a green light on the dash saying "READY) 😊 just press the Accelerator, 

 Captain Mainwaring dads army came to mind " Phillip you stupid boy" Phil it still brings a smile to my face after a good few years when I drive off in silence but be aware pedestrian won't hear the car coming you will have to watch out for them especially in supermarket car parks . A lot of the motoring press slam the CVT  gearbox Lexus /Toyota wrongly Yes if you floor the gas pedal on joining a motorway to get up to speed it's loud not a problem  . The reason it's so noticeable is the cars are so quiet 99% of the time. My son in law mentioned this last week when he was in the RAV 4

"Phil this is so quiet " The Lexus SUV to me and other owners just seems to want to wafted you away in fabulous comfort and ultra quiet

I do like the 3 driving mods Eco/normal/sport. All my new hybrids I've run the engine  in , old habits 

I drive in eco for the first 500 miles then over the next 500 introduce normal and sport . One last thing if I may my late Dad was an upholster all his life and his tip leather seats worst enemy grit i hoover my seats once a month then wipe with a damp cloth
